      I constructed an email signature with a timestamp that worked in Outlook 2000. It only works when you use Word as your email editor. I used a DATE field. In Outlook 2002, the field is inserted, but doesn’t reflect the correct time. Instead, it shows the time when the signature was created. I can update the field and get the correct time, but I don’t always remember, making this feature very dubious. Is there a way to force the field to update automatically, that is without hitting F9?
